hrev45072 adds 1 changeset to branch 'master' old head: 46f1daff68176b7e003ddae46fce11f4b92340dd new head: 3fbf5d68095bfbb82dbb876130fb66dd52a6dd1e overview: http://cgit.haiku-os.org/haiku/log/?qt=range&q=3fbf5d6+%5E46f1daf ---------------------------------------------------------------------------- 3fbf5d6: Tracker: Drawing artifact (#6513) After switching from outline only selection mode to transparent rectangle, a drawing artifact could occur because the last selection rectangle wasn't reset properly. On following update, Tracker thought a selection rectangle was still to be shown. [ Philippe Saint-Pierre <stpere@xxxxxxxxx> ] ---------------------------------------------------------------------------- Revision: hrev45072 Commit: 3fbf5d68095bfbb82dbb876130fb66dd52a6dd1e URL: http://cgit.haiku-os.org/haiku/commit/?id=3fbf5d6 Author: Philippe Saint-Pierre <stpere@xxxxxxxxx> Date: Sun Dec 23 21:30:34 2012 UTC Ticket: https://dev.haiku-os.org/ticket/6513 ---------------------------------------------------------------------------- 1 file changed, 1 insertion(+) src/kits/tracker/PoseView.cpp | 1 + ---------------------------------------------------------------------------- diff --git a/src/kits/tracker/PoseView.cpp b/src/kits/tracker/PoseView.cpp index 8e9c53f..9c4971c 100644 --- a/src/kits/tracker/PoseView.cpp +++ b/src/kits/tracker/PoseView.cpp @@ -6956,6 +6956,7 @@ BPoseView::_EndSelectionRect() SetDrawingMode(B_OP_INVERT); StrokeRect(fSelectionRectInfo.rect, B_MIXED_COLORS); SetDrawingMode(B_OP_COPY); + fSelectionRectInfo.rect.Set(0, 0, -1, -1); } else { Invalidate(fSelectionRectInfo.rect); fSelectionRectInfo.rect.Set(0, 0, -1, -1);